The cost of living difference between Batavia, IL and LaSalle, IL is dramatic. LaSalle is 41% cheaper than Batavia,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Batavia has a cost index of 103 while LaSalle sits at 73,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.

On the housing front, median rent in Batavia is $1,255/month compared to $1,011/month in LaSalle — a 24%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: LaSalle is more affordable at $109,500 median vs $358,000.

Median household income in Batavia is $119,167 compared to $54,246 in LaSalle (+119.7%). While Batavia is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Batavia spend roughly 12.6% of their income on rent, less than the 22.4% in LaSalle.
